FSSAI Registration in India
The Food Safety and Standards Authority of India (FSSAI) is a government body that regulates and supervises food safety standards in India. FSSAI Registration is mandatory for all food business operators (FBOs) in India to ensure the food they sell is safe for consumption and complies with the necessary safety and hygiene standards.
FSSAI ensures that food products meet the standards specified under the Food Safety and Standards Act, 2006, which helps to protect public health.
Types of FSSAI Registration
1. FSSAI Registration (Basic Registration):
o For small food businesses with an annual turnover of up to ₹12 lakh.
o Typically applicable to small manufacturers, retailers, or food vendors.
2. FSSAI License (State License):
o For medium-sized food businesses with an annual turnover between ₹12 lakh and ₹20 crore.
o It is required for businesses like restaurants, food processors, distributors, and importers.
3. FSSAI License (Central License):
o For large food businesses with an annual turnover above ₹20 crore or those involved in inter-state or international trade.
o This is required for large-scale food manufacturing, export businesses, and food importers.

Documents Required for FSSAI Registration
For Basic Registration:
1. Aadhaar card of the proprietor or food business operator.
2. Proof of business address (e.g., utility bill, lease/rent agreement).
3. PAN card of the business or proprietor.
4. Passport-sized photograph of the proprietor.
5. Business activity details (like name of business, type of food handling, etc.).
For State/ Central License:
1. Aadhaar card and PAN card of the proprietor/authorized signatory.
2. Certificate of incorporation (for companies).
3. Proof of business address (e.g., lease/rent agreement or utility bills).
4. Food safety management system plan.
5. List of food products (details of food being manufactured or handled).
6. List of equipment used in food production.
7. Health certificates (for food manufacturers, etc.).
8. NOC (No Objection Certificate) from the local municipal authority.

Benefits of FSSAI Registration
1. Legal Recognition: FSSAI registration ensures that your food business complies with the food safety standards mandated by the government.
2. Market Credibility: Being FSSAI-certified improves the reputation of your business and attracts consumers who value safety and quality.
3. Access to Government Schemes: MSMEs, small businesses, and startups with FSSAI registration can avail various government schemes and financial assistance.
4. Consumer Confidence: Registration increases consumer confidence as it assures that the food sold is safe and meets regulatory standards.
5. Protection from Legal Actions: An FSSAI registration protects businesses from penalties and legal issues related to non-compliance with food safety standards.
